Tottenham goalkeeper was back on form for France last night.

Hugo Lloris proved a point during France’s draw with Iceland last night.
The Tottenham Hotspur star returned to action last week against Barcelona and it went terribly.
He cost his team a goal after just two minutes and then looked nervous throughout the game and was lucky to only concede four goals.
Last night against Iceland he showed signs he is getting back to his best, despite France only managing a 2-2 draw.

Midway through the first half Lloris pulled off a terrific triple save, showing great reflexes to deny a flourish of Icelandic efforts.
The French team’s Twitter account praised Lloris, comparing him to a wall.
Of course this was speaking too soon. Lloris conceded twice, although there was little he could do about the goals.
His saves will help his confidence if it was feeling shaky, but a tough test awaits early next week, when France host Germany.
